Reports and Statistics: Friday 28 February 2020

2 min read

The National Audit Office has published a report on the protection of gamblers

The Welsh Government has published a consultation on framework for regional investment in Wales

Nationwide has published its house price index for February 

Which? has published research on levels of CO2 produced by older in comparison to newer model cars 

Her Majesty's Inspectorate of Probation and HM Inspectorate of Constabulary and Fire & Rescue Services have published a joint inspection report on the Integrates Offender Management system

The British Retail Consortium publishes a report on monthly UK economic briefing

The Confederation of British Industry publishes its quarterly survey on the service sector 

NAHT publishes a statement on the plans to close maintained nursery schools 

The National Institute for Health and Care Excellence has published guidance on Intrapartum care: existing medical conditions and obstetric complications (QS - Final)

HM Revenue & Customs publishes statistics on Alcohol bulletin: January 2020, Help to Save statistics

NHS England publishes statistics on Quarterly hospital activity data for Q3 2019/20

The Office for National Statistics publishes statistics on UK trade in services by industry, country and service type: 2016 to 2018, UK natural capital: woodland and Overseas travel and tourism: November and December 2019 provisional results

The Marine Management Organisation publishes statistics on Monthly Sea Fisheries Statistics December 2019

The Northern Ireland Statistics and Research Agency publishes statistics on Monthly Births and Deaths (Northern Ireland): January 2020
